## Releases

GateCount builds are tagged from main. CI produces a static binary for the turnstile units at Harrowfield Arena and signs it before upload. Firmware refuses unsigned images, so never sideload manually. Version bumps follow semver; patch releases only for count-drift fixes. Release notes live in NOTES.md. Verify each artifact against the checksum file before flashing, and reject anything older than v3.0 — earlier counters overflow at 65k entries. The release signing key used to verify artifacts is the following.

rollout seal: bky4_x7Gc

Handover Note — From D. Arlesh to M. Quenby

Marta, quick rundown before I'm off. The hiring freeze in the Coastal Division stays in place through at least next quarter — no exceptions, even for the two open account-exec roles in Perlow Bay. Sales leads should plan territories around current headcount and lean on the Brightmane inside-sales pool for overflow. Keep expectations realistic in pipeline reviews; don't promise coverage we can't staff. The reasoning behind the freeze ties directly to the confidential plan noted below.

board note of kageg-bahof: The renewal with Holwynax Holdings closes at $2 million a year, 5 percent below the last contract. Project Ulaath slips by two quarters because of the supplier delay.

**Runbook: Audit-log viewer — Ferrowatch**

If folks report the Ferrowatch audit-log viewer showing stale entries, it's almost always the indexer lagging, not data loss. Check the indexer lag metric first — under 5 minutes is fine, just wait it out. Over 15 minutes, restart the indexer pod on the Duskvale cluster; it catches up fast. Don't touch the retention job while the indexer is behind, that's how we got the gap last quarter. Step-by-step restart instructions and the escalation rota are on the page below.

runbook for yafof-kahif: https://jira.qorvelsys.internal/browse/display/pages/browse/0c52

Ticket #4471 — DupeSquash merges unrelated alerts

Hey folks, DupeSquash is collapsing alerts from different services into one incident. Repro: trigger a disk alert on the Kettle cluster, then a latency alert on Pinefield within 30 seconds — both land under one incident card. Happens on staging too. To reproduce via the API, authenticate with the staging token below.

session JWT of yawep-yawep = eyJhbGciOiJIUzI1NiIsInR5cCI6IkpXVCJ9.eyJzdWIiOiI3pWF3_In0.aXYsHiog